Transaction c84ae30da18c5afe9f64ecb474b647cf29934ac503b4168919a495afac42993e
1 Input
1 Output
-
c84ae30da18c5afe9f64ecb474b647cf29934ac503b4168919a495afac42993e:0
- value
- 77992691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72383d97d0386f44d6f7cb86120c3bdc726d5b73 OP_EQUAL
- address
- 3C6xL5TVkm48GD4VaBQ2TCm1sd3gqzKmwr